Combine, TX is a small town located in Kaufman County, Texas. While it may seem like a peaceful and quiet community, it is not immune to crime. According to recent statistics, the town's violent crime rate is 14.1, which is lower than the national average of 22.7. This means that residents of Combine are less likely to be victims of violent crimes such as assault, robbery, and murder. However, the property crime rate in Combine is 25.6, which is also lower than the US average of 35.4. This includes crimes like burglary, theft, and motor vehicle theft. While the crime rate in Combine may be lower than the national average, it is still important for residents to remain vigilant and take necessary precautions to protect themselves and their property.

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)

Combine violent crime is 14.1. (The US average is 22.7)
Combine property crime is 25.6. (The US average is 35.4)
